Output 720d352169c72d5f6293ea5721ec48e3cf54826f1c012d7c969b4539899c1e8b:19

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 36cc423be64bb8051ccb8a6e0df7a8effbe9bc0d2d7c7372b0c430712f6cd2a4
address
bc1pxmxyywlxfwuq28xt3fhqmaagala7n0qd9478xu4scsc8ztmv62jqnzcawg
transaction
720d352169c72d5f6293ea5721ec48e3cf54826f1c012d7c969b4539899c1e8b
spent
true